set dot1x key-tx

Enables or disables the transmission of encryption key information to the supplicant (client) in EAP over LAN (EAPoL) key messages, after authentication is successful.

Syntax set dot1x key-tx {enable disable}

enable

Enables transmission of encryption key information to clients.

disable

Disables transmission of encryption key information to clients.

Defaults Key transmission is enabled by default.

Access Enabled.

History Introduced in WSS Software 1.0.

Examples Type the following command to enable key transmission:

WSS# set dot1x key-tx enable

success: dot1x key transmission enabled.

set dot1x max-req

Sets the maximum number of times the WSS retransmits an EAP request to a supplicant (client) before ending the authentication session.

Syntax set dot1x max-reqnumber-of-retransmissions

number-of-retransmissions

Specify a value between 0 and 10.

Defaults The default number of EAP retransmissions is 2.

Access Enabled.
